ABOUT US At Vida, we help people get better — and we’re helping the healthcare system get better, too. Vida is a virtual health clinic that provides expert, personalized, on-demand health coaching and programs from a network of experienced health care providers — like Prescribers, Registered Dietitians, Therapists and Health Coaches — through an easy-to-use app. We focus on managing chronic cardiometabolic conditions — like diabetes, obesity and hypertension — as well as achieving lifestyle health goals like eating more healthfully, getting more exercise, losing weight and reducing stress. By combining advanced technology with the top-notch healthcare providers, Vida is breaking down the barriers that have historically kept people from getting the best care. Vida Therapist works virtually with a range of members to help support impactful, lasting behavior change to increase health and wellness. In addition, you will work within Vida’s guidelines, Scope of Practice, HIPAA, PHI, Industry Standards, Federal, State and Local Law to ensure that safety, quality, and compliance expectations are met. Vida Therapists are professional experts in mental health who are fully licensed to screen, diagnose and treat mental health conditions. They support members by providing evidence-based psychotherapy. \n Responsibilities: Manage a panel of clients providing evidence-based assessment, treatment plans and therapeutic interventions, meeting or exceeding completed consult expectations as outlined in Vidapedia Configure Vida Coach calendar to allow clients to schedule, and maintain regular contact with them using Vida’s in-app video calls and messaging, per Vida’s program design and policies.
